@font-face {
	font-family: 'Linearicons-Free';
	src:url('fonts/Linearicons-Free.eot?w118d');
	src:url('fonts/Linearicons-Free.eot?#iefixw118d') format('embedded-opentype'),
		url('fonts/Linearicons-Free.woff2?w118d') format('woff2'),
		url('fonts/Linearicons-Free.woff?w118d') format('woff'),
		url('fonts/Linearicons-Free.ttf?w118d') format('truetype'),
		url('fonts/Linearicons-Free.svg?w118d#Linearicons-Free') format('svg');
	font-weight: normal;
	font-style: normal;
}

.kufi {
	font-family: 'Linearicons-Free';
	speak: none;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	line-height: 1;

	/* Better Font Rendering =========== */
	-webkit-font-smoothing: antialiased;
	-moz-osx-font-smoothing: grayscale;
}

.kufi-home:before {
	content: "";
}
.kufi-apartment:before {
	content: "";
}
.kufi-pencil:before {
	content: "";
}
.kufi-magic-wand:before {
	content: "";
}
.kufi-drop:before {
	content: "";
}
.kufi-lighter:before {
	content: "";
}
.kufi-poop:before {
	content: "";
}
.kufi-sun:before {
	content: "";
}
.kufi-moon:before {
	content: "";
}
.kufi-cloud:before {
	content: "";
}
.kufi-cloud-upload:before {
	content: "";
}
.kufi-cloud-download:before {
	content: "";
}
.kufi-cloud-sync:before {
	content: "";
}
.kufi-cloud-check:before {
	content: "";
}
.kufi-database:before {
	content: "";
}
.kufi-lock:before {
	content: "";
}
.kufi-cog:before {
	content: "";
}
.kufi-trash:before {
	content: "";
}
.kufi-dice:before {
	content: "";
}
.kufi-heart:before {
	content: "";
}
.kufi-star:before {
	content: "";
}
.kufi-star-half:before {
	content: "";
}
.kufi-star-empty:before {
	content: "";
}
.kufi-flag:before {
	content: "";
}
.kufi-envelope:before {
	content: "";
}
.kufi-paperclip:before {
	content: "";
}
.kufi-inbox:before {
	content: "";
}
.kufi-eye:before {
	content: "";
}
.kufi-printer:before {
	content: "";
}
.kufi-file-empty:before {
	content: "";
}
.kufi-file-add:before {
	content: "";
}
.kufi-enter:before {
	content: "";
}
.kufi-exit:before {
	content: "";
}
.kufi-graduation-hat:before {
	content: "";
}
.kufi-license:before {
	content: "";
}
.kufi-music-note:before {
	content: "";
}
.kufi-film-play:before {
	content: "";
}
.kufi-camera-video:before {
	content: "";
}
.kufi-camera:before {
	content: "";
}
.kufi-picture:before {
	content: "";
}
.kufi-book:before {
	content: "";
}
.kufi-bookmark:before {
	content: "";
}
.kufi-user:before {
	content: "";
}
.kufi-users:before {
	content: "";
}
.kufi-shirt:before {
	content: "";
}
.kufi-store:before {
	content: "";
}
.kufi-cart:before {
	content: "";
}
.kufi-tag:before {
	content: "";
}
.kufi-phone-handset:before {
	content: "";
}
.kufi-phone:before {
	content: "";
}
.kufi-pushpin:before {
	content: "";
}
.kufi-map-marker:before {
	content: "";
}
.kufi-map:before {
	content: "";
}
.kufi-location:before {
	content: "";
}
.kufi-calendar-full:before {
	content: "";
}
.kufi-keyboard:before {
	content: "";
}
.kufi-spell-check:before {
	content: "";
}
.kufi-screen:before {
	content: "";
}
.kufi-smartphone:before {
	content: "";
}
.kufi-tablet:before {
	content: "";
}
.kufi-laptop:before {
	content: "";
}
.kufi-laptop-phone:before {
	content: "";
}
.kufi-power-switch:before {
	content: "";
}
.kufi-bubble:before {
	content: "";
}
.kufi-heart-pulse:before {
	content: "";
}
.kufi-construction:before {
	content: "";
}
.kufi-pie-chart:before {
	content: "";
}
.kufi-chart-bars:before {
	content: "";
}
.kufi-gift:before {
	content: "";
}
.kufi-diamond:before {
	content: "";
}
.kufi-linearicons:before {
	content: "";
}
.kufi-dinner:before {
	content: "";
}
.kufi-coffee-cup:before {
	content: "";
}
.kufi-leaf:before {
	content: "";
}
.kufi-paw:before {
	content: "";
}
.kufi-rocket:before {
	content: "";
}
.kufi-briefcase:before {
	content: "";
}
.kufi-bus:before {
	content: "";
}
.kufi-car:before {
	content: "";
}
.kufi-train:before {
	content: "";
}
.kufi-bicycle:before {
	content: "";
}
.kufi-wheelchair:before {
	content: "";
}
.kufi-select:before {
	content: "";
}
.kufi-earth:before {
	content: "";
}
.kufi-smile:before {
	content: "";
}
.kufi-sad:before {
	content: "";
}
.kufi-neutral:before {
	content: "";
}
.kufi-mustache:before {
	content: "";
}
.kufi-alarm:before {
	content: "";
}
.kufi-bullhorn:before {
	content: "";
}
.kufi-volume-high:before {
	content: "";
}
.kufi-volume-medium:before {
	content: "";
}
.kufi-volume-low:before {
	content: "";
}
.kufi-volume:before {
	content: "";
}
.kufi-mic:before {
	content: "";
}
.kufi-hourglass:before {
	content: "";
}
.kufi-undo:before {
	content: "";
}
.kufi-redo:before {
	content: "";
}
.kufi-sync:before {
	content: "";
}
.kufi-history:before {
	content: "";
}
.kufi-clock:before {
	content: "";
}
.kufi-download:before {
	content: "";
}
.kufi-upload:before {
	content: "";
}
.kufi-enter-down:before {
	content: "";
}
.kufi-exit-up:before {
	content: "";
}
.kufi-bug:before {
	content: "";
}
.kufi-code:before {
	content: "";
}
.kufi-link:before {
	content: "";
}
.kufi-unlink:before {
	content: "";
}
.kufi-thumbs-up:before {
	content: "";
}
.kufi-thumbs-down:before {
	content: "";
}
.fozic:before {
	content: "";
}
.kufi-cross:before {
	content: "";
}
.kufi-menu:before {
	content: "";
}
.kufi-list:before {
	content: "";
}
.kufi-chevron-up:before {
	content: "";
}
.kufi-chevron-down:before {
	content: "";
}
.kufi-chevron-left:before {
	content: "";
}
.kufi-chevron-right:before {
	content: "";
}
.kufi-arrow-up:before {
	content: "";
}
.kufi-arrow-down:before {
	content: "";
}
.kufi-arrow-left:before {
	content: "";
}
.kufi-arrow-right:before {
	content: "";
}
.kufi-move:before {
	content: "";
}
.kufi-warning:before {
	content: "";
}
.kufi-question-circle:before {
	content: "";
}
.kufi-menu-circle:before {
	content: "";
}
.kufi-checkmark-circle:before {
	content: "";
}
.kufi-cross-circle:before {
	content: "";
}
.kufi-plus-circle:before {
	content: "";
}
.kufi-circle-minus:before {
	content: "";
}
.kufi-arrow-up-circle:before {
	content: "";
}
.kufi-arrow-down-circle:before {
	content: "";
}
.kufi-arrow-left-circle:before {
	content: "";
}
.kufi-arrow-right-circle:before {
	content: "";
}
.kufi-chevron-up-circle:before {
	content: "";
}
.kufi-chevron-down-circle:before {
	content: "";
}
.kufi-chevron-left-circle:before {
	content: "";
}
.kufi-chevron-right-circle:before {
	content: "";
}
.kufi-crop:before {
	content: "";
}
.kufi-frame-expand:before {
	content: "";
}
.kufi-frame-contract:before {
	content: "";
}
.kufi-layers:before {
	content: "";
}
.kufi-funnel:before {
	content: "";
}
.kufi-text-format:before {
	content: "";
}
.kufi-text-format-remove:before {
	content: "";
}
.kufi-text-size:before {
	content: "";
}
.kufi-bold:before {
	content: "";
}
.kufi-italic:before {
	content: "";
}
.kufi-underline:before {
	content: "";
}
.kufi-strikethrough:before {
	content: "";
}
.kufi-highlight:before {
	content: "";
}
.kufi-text-align-left:before {
	content: "";
}
.kufi-text-align-center:before {
	content: "";
}
.kufi-text-align-right:before {
	content: "";
}
.kufi-text-align-justify:before {
	content: "";
}
.kufi-line-spacing:before {
	content: "";
}
.kufi-indent-increase:before {
	content: "";
}
.kufi-indent-decrease:before {
	content: "";
}
.kufi-pilcrow:before {
	content: "";
}
.kufi-direction-ltr:before {
	content: "";
}
.kufi-direction-rtl:before {
	content: "";
}
.kufi-page-break:before {
	content: "";
}
.kufi-sort-alpha-asc:before {
	content: "";
}
.kufi-sort-amount-asc:before {
	content: "";
}
.kufi-hand:before {
	content: "";
}
.kufi-pointer-up:before {
	content: "";
}
.kufi-pointer-right:before {
	content: "";
}
.kufi-pointer-down:before {
	content: "";
}
.kufi-pointer-left:before {
	content: "";
}
